Rocket launch SS-520-3 / JAXA

Rocket SS520-3 from JAXA departed this morning at 10:09:25 UTC! On the second day of the lauching window, congratulation to JAXA & Andoya Space Center team that worked on it.
I kind of heard that all parameters sounds nominal (science and lauching aspects), which makes it an even greater achievement!
Spectacular launch, everybody in town were very excited about it ! I got a nice shot of the launch featuring the Blue House of AWIPEV. We can see the full burst of the first booster, second booster was unfortunately too vertical, on top of our heads [image: 🙁].
